One article which I thought would apply to both professional and novice Mac users is “Keyboard Shortcuts.”
Bearing in mind “command” on the Mac has the same function as “control” in Windows, some of you PC users will notice that several of the shortcuts are exactly the same, if not very similar to those found in Windows - a sure sign it shouldn’t take too long to re-remember your way around the keyboard.
